The Food and Hospitality Asia Maldives exhibition will be held at the Dharubaaruge Exhibition Centre in Male, Maldives from 4th April to 6th April 2017. The event is organized by CDC Events & Travel Pvt Ltd and is set to be the largest event hosted for the hospitality industry in Maldives. Luxury hotels and resorts from Maldives such as Adaaran Club Rannalhi and properties from other Asian countries use the FHAM Culinary Challenge as a meeting platform for local and international F&B executives to meet chefs from around the Asian region. The event which will feature over 110 stalls selling a range of products and services by local, regional and international companies and is set to attract senior management, owners and staff at hotels, resorts, guest houses, restaurants etc.
